As corn planting wraps up across the Dairyland Seed footprint, sides dress application of nitrogen will begin soon, and in many cases has begun. There is no “one size fits all” nitrogen management program. Variables such as soil type, type of nitrogen fertilizer applied, application timing, etc. all have an impact on determining total program.
When does nitrogen use peak in corn? On average, N use peaks in corn between the V6 and R1 (silking) growth stages. Corn will accumulate 70 percent of nitrogen that it will need during this period. Nitrogen availability during this time is critical for corn growth and development. The nitrogen stored in the plant during vegetive growth is remobilized during maturity and can account for over half of the N found in the grain.

How much N to apply? Nitrogen use efficiency in corn has increased over the last 50 years as illustrated by the graph. Factors such as N products used, application timing, and efficiency of modern hybrids play a role in this increase in efficiency. As shown by the graph, 1.1 to 0.8 pounds of N are required to produce a bushel of grain. It is important to note that the graph refers to total N applied to the corn crop -- not just side dress application.

What about Nitrogen stabilizers? A nitrogen stabilizer is a product added to Nitrogen fertilizer that keeps the N in the most stable, ammonium (NH4+ ) form for a longer period. The ammonium form of Nitrogen is not mobile in the soil, but through nitrification, ammonium is turned to nitrate (NO3- ) which is mobile in the soil and prone to leaching or denitrification.
The two types of nitrogen stabilizers are urease inhibitors and nitrification inhibitors. Urease inhibitors are added to surface-applied nitrogen fertilizers to inhibit ammonia volitation or “gassing off”. Nitrification inhibitors are added to incorporated nitrogen fertilizers and work to inhibit the biological activities that turn ammoniacal nitrogen to nitrate. Nitrate is mobile and prone to leaching through the soil profile. Corn can use both ammonium and nitrate forms of Nitrogen. Each of these stabilizer additives work to keep the fertilizer where you put it and keep it available to the crop for a longer period.
